The Amazon Eurobike, our rubbish but popular budget bike, is back for another GCN challenge, this time being ridden by Astana Qazaqstan Team pro cyclist and Giro d’Italia stage winner, Joe Dombrowski. He’s up against our super amateur Ollie, who will ride the Wilier 0 SLR, in a race up the iconic Coll de Rates.This is cheap bike pro rider vs super bike amateur rider: climbing edition!

  • My first road bike is a Eurobike. It is crazy heavy, but it will make some good riding legs after riding it a few times. Yes, it has several pitfalls, but for a newbie with a very tight budget, it isn't bad for a new road bike. However, I wouldn't recommend getting too chummy with it for long if a person wants to get serious later. A few issues with it is the quality of the derailleur and the size of the chain ring. The derailleur will junk up after some time of serious rides. Also, the chain ring is a bit smaller than that of a typical road bike, possibly because the parts seem to be a mix from something that resemble various types of bikes. A positive aspect to the Eurobike is that the frame can stand a beating for how heavy this tank on two wheels is. I don't ride mine any longer except for when I am screwing around. Note: if a person is just learning how to use clips, this is the bike to do it with because a person new to clips will fall, dropping the bike a few times along with banging up the knees.
